The Night Tiger by Yangsze Choo

Set in 1930s colonial Malaysia, this captivating novel intertwines the lives of a young dressmaker's apprentice, Ji Lin, and an orphaned houseboy, Ren, as they become entangled in a series of mysterious events involving a severed finger, a missing doctor, and local superstitions about men transforming into tigers. As they each pursue their own quests—Ji Lin to return the finger to its rightful owner and Ren to fulfill his former master's dying wish—their paths converge, revealing secrets and connections that challenge their understanding of fate, duty, and the supernatural.
